SDY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

641 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R S&P Dividend ETF (SDY)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$4.9B — down 1.8% from $4.99B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 36 funds opened new SDY positions and 32 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 198 added to existing stakes and 258 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Cornerstone Wealth Management, adding an estimated $616M. The largest seller was Bessemer Group, cutting an estimated $27.1M.
